Gaumukhi Rural Municipality

Gaumukhi is a Rural municipality located within the Pyuthan District of the Lumbini Province of Nepal. The rural municipality spans 139.04 square kilometres (53.68 sq mi) of area, with a total population of 25,421 according to a 2011 Nepal census.[1] [2]

On March 10, 2017, the Government of Nepal restructured the local level bodies into 753 new local level structures. [3] [4] The previous Arkha Rajwara, Puja, Khung, portion of Libang and Narikot VDCs were merged to form Gaumukhi Rural Municipality. Gaumukhi is divided into 7 wards, with Puja declared the administrative center of the rural municipality.
